Output 503e5141ffd94eb329c240d4f400491131069c09cbfe416f03f783e4fdd9406d:0

value
22053250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76519ade8e5360fa03439390bcfd63f9ec52aecc OP_EQUAL
address
3CUdRC4zJb83SV7fSAVi3fjUySzEEq2RVu
transaction
503e5141ffd94eb329c240d4f400491131069c09cbfe416f03f783e4fdd9406d
spent
true